There are now over one million confirmed cases of coronavirus around the world, with nearly 50 thousand lives lost. In the US, there are 245,280 confirmed cases and 6,095 people have died. 12 percent of cases in America require hospitalization (on par with Italy), but in Spain, 18 percent of cases require hospitalization. President Trump says the White House is considering suggesting all Americans wear a face mask when in public (or another covering), though it wouldn't be mandatory...but some cities and towns are beyond that. For example, residents of Laredo, TX can now be fined up to $1,000 for not wearing a mask in public. Antibody tests now are being accelerated in the US, and tests might be available within a few weeks...that means anybody with the COVID-19 antibody could return to work (though human immunities are usually seasonal and do NOT mean you cannot catch the virus again). USS Naval Hospital ships have docked now in New York City and LA, but they remain empty. The USS Comfort in NYC only has 20 patients on board, and there are only 15 patients onboard the USS Mercy in Los Angeles.
